Mercer Engineering Research Center (MERC), a research institute of Mercer University, provides high quality engineering, scientific, and technical support services to both government and private industry customers.

The Senior Draftsperson will be using computer-aided design (CAD) to provide engineering drawings and drafting to support the MERC engineering staff under the supervision of the respective chief engineer.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Utilizes SolidWorks and AutoCAD to develop engineering models and drawings

  • Uses ASME-Y14.100, ASME-Y14.24, ASME-Y14.35 and ASME-Y14.34, MIL-STD-31000, IEEE, ANSI, and other related standards to prepare drawings

  • Provides detailed coordination and development of engineering drawings IAW with MERC standard processes

  • Performs check of engineering drawings including schematics, parts lists, and electrical interconnect listings

  • Assists in the establishment of MERC drafting standards and PDM workflow and ensures compliance across the Center

  • Assists other drafting personnel

  • Approves engineering drawings for release

  • Supports and executes other tasks as assigned by the responsible supervisor

  • Ensures familiarity with all MERC core capabilities and with current and potential customer base

  • During all customer contacts, remains alert for any potential problems or opportunities that could possibly lead to additional business for any MERC core capability area

  • Report all perceived or identified MERC business opportunities to the Director of Acquisition Strategy through a Chief Engineer

    RE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S:

  • US Citizenship is required.

  • Ability to obtain and maintain a DoD Security Clearance.

  • Formal training, course work, or certification and 9 years of directly related experience with ASME-Y14.100, ASME-Y14.24, ASME-Y14.35, and ASME-Y14.34, MIL-STD-31000, IEEE, ANSI, and other related standards to prepare drawings is required.

  • Experience creating part and assembly models and fabrication drawings via CAD system.

  • Experience creating part and assembly models and drawings in SolidWorks.

  • Experience creating 2D drawings/blueprints for fabrication in AutoCAD.

    MERC is a non-profit research institute of Mercer University, a private university founded in 1833. Established in 1987 in Warner Robins, GA, MERC employs more than 200 engineers, scientists, professors, and support staff, who provide sustainable research solutions to government agencies, the Department of Defense, and commercial customers around the world.
